UK LOBBYING SCANDAL WIDENS

Former UK Prime Minister David Cameron has suggested he will cooperate with a series of inquiries taking place into lobbying.

He's faced criticism over his contact with current ministers when he was working for Greensill Capital prior to its collapse.

An ex senior Civil Servant has also been caught up in the row after it emerged he was still working for government when he took up a role with Greensill in 2015.

Former House of Commons Clerk Eliot Wilson believes the issues need to be looked into separately.
